Bianchi, who was coach of Napoli's first Scudetto-winning team with Diego Maradona and Careca, saw the Azzurri draw with Inter Milan yesterday with McTominay scoring twice.

He told Radio Anchi'o Sport: "I enjoyed myself; I liked Inter-Napoli. It was an intense and fair match. Perhaps the two coaches won't be entirely satisfied; they're very demanding. But as an outside observer, it was a great show, with a good pace, similar to English matches.

"Being caught up like that, twice, isn't nice. But they faced a well-organized team; Napoli performed like a truly great team. Coming back twice at San Siro like that isn't something everyone can do.

"McTominay? We haven't seen a player like him in a long time. At Coverciano, he was once called a universal player: he can interpret the game defensively, in midfield, and even in scoring.

"He would have played for my Maradona-led Napoli: a player like that can play everywhere."
